Components

The current features of the app are the following:

  • A simple app for handling Bluetooth discovery and pairing. This project is open-source. The code is distributed under MIT license.
  • Can send and receive files like images, videos, recording, music, documents and the like.

Proposal

After my exploration, I would like to suggest the following:

  • Add a “sent files” button which has a history of sent out transaction and primary details of the file (e.g. resolution, size, file type, date of transaction/transfer, time of transaction/transfer, receiver name and etc.)
  • Add a “sort” button which has sort by: name, time, file size, file type, date of transaction/transfer, receiver name, and etc. Except for the date and time of transaction/transfer, sorting is already A-Z sorted.

Benefits

Here are the benefits once my proposal for the components/parts/sections of the software will be implemented and solved:

  • With the help of the sent files button, users will be able to see if he/she had successfully sent the files or not.
  • He/she can also identify on “to whom he/she had sent the file” and who else haven’t received it.
  • With the sort button, user will be able to view the files he/she sent according to his/her choice of sorting, whether in time, resolution, size, file type, date of transaction and/or receiver name.
